RESEARCH
Dr. Duffield’s primary research interests revolve around the formation, implementation, and maintenance of professional development school partnerships. This includes how new and existing educational professionals are trained and supported, and the use of school and classroom research to inform instructional decisions. In this context, she is particularly interested in how technology can transform school environments to: (a) create learning communities that extend beyond the school, (b) involve students in solving real and important problems, and (c) better prepare new teachers and other educational professionals to teach in their own classrooms.
